WebFeb 12, 2024 · Septic shock is the most common cause of acute kidney injury in the ICU accounting for approximately half of all acute kidney injuries and is associated with the highest mortality. 59 Renal replacement … WebTherefore, a new consensus was sought. Septic shock was newly defined as ‘a subset of sepsis in which circulatory, cellular and metabolic abnormalities are associated with a greater risk of mortality than sepsis alone.’ 5 Operationally, they identified septic shock as being present when the two particular conditions were met (Box 2).

Drewry AM, Samra N, Skrupky … WebSepsis and Septic Shock. Sepsis is a clinical syndrome of life-threatening organ dysfunction caused by a dysregulated response to infection. In septic shock, there is critical reduction in tissue perfusion; acute failure of multiple organs, including the lungs, kidneys, and liver, can occur. WebExercise is a theoretically possible, but unlikely confounder of lactic acidosis as a diagnostic tool for sepsis. Its half-life for most people is about 20 minutes, so within an hour after exercise, it gets pretty close to baseline levels.
